Telltale’s Game of Thrones to Start Before Year’s End

Telltale’s Game of Thrones to Start Before Year’s End

Several months ago, back in in mid-December last here, The Walking Dead developer Telltale Games announced that it would be working on an episodic series set within the Game of Thrones universe.

Though news of the game has been predominantly silent since its announcement, aside from Destiny writer Joshua Rubin joining Telltale to help in the series’ development and the poster teaser that was released a few weeks back, the renowned developer has finally come out to confirm when to expect the first episode of its Game of Thrones adaptation.

Publically declared via Twitter, Telltale Games’ community manager, Laura Perusco, revealed last week that the studio’s first Game of Thrones episode would premier later on this year, though no specific date beyond that was detailed.

@RatedR2012 No specific release date announced yet, but I can confirm that the season IS premiering later this year. 🙂

— Laura Perusco (@lauraperusco) October 24, 2014

This new series from the Walking Dead developer is slated to debut digitally on consoles, Mac and PC, and mobile devices. We’ll bring you more news on Telltale Games’ Game of Thrones should further information each our ears.
